c语言 下面这个程序哪里有错误?求高手解答
哪位高手帮忙看看这个C语言程序哪里错了!运行的结果不对啊!
输入语句scanf("%f,%f,%d",&p,&w,&s);你写的输入格式是 %f,%f,%d 所以你输入的时候,数据只能是逗号,否则就错误.一般情况输入语句改为scanf("%f%f%d",&p,&w,&s); 这样输入的时候就可以用空格隔开.
我写了个c语言程序,不知道哪里错了,求大神告诉
不仅是大家说的错误,你的判断条件也错了,我的是正确的,你试试.#include <stdio.h> main() { char b[50]; int j=0,k=0,l=0,m=0,i=0; printf("请输入至多50个字符:\n").
求C语言高手解答,这个哪里错了谢谢
定义和声明必须一致,不然就出问题了
请帮我看一下,下面的c语言哪里有错误?
你在最开始处加一行 #include<stdio.h>就好了.没有头文件编译不了的.
请问这个C语言代码哪里有错?麻烦大神帮忙看看..
a是int,b是int结果也会是int,如果要浮点型结果需要转一下float c= a/b;改为float c=(float)a/b;楼上说的不对,前面已经定义了函数返回类型是int
有一个c语言的程序运行一半电脑总是提示有错误哪里错了请高手指教!
一般为内存问题代码拿出来看看
求c语言高手告诉这程序哪里有问题
你要是copy代码出来就更好了,可以复制的那种代码
求高手帮我看一下这一个c语言程序,到底是哪里出错了.
代码呢
求大神解惑:下面这个程序错在哪里(C语言,用VC++运行显示有错误)#incl.
你的代码没有发完,重新发一次吧
C语言一程序错误在哪?
#include <stdio.h>#include <math.h>int f(int a,int b)//后面缺个逗号{ int z; z=a,a=b,b=z; return(a,b);}main(){int x,y;scanf("%d,%d",x,y);printf("%d,%d",f(x,y));getchar();}